  • Patent number: 10759551
    Abstract: An ejection head for an ejection device of a sealing machine for sealing a container includes a supporting element with a supporting axis and a sliding end, and a sliding element for sliding the supporting element along a sliding profile of the sealing machine. The sliding element is arranged at the sliding end and a force acting essentially in the direction of the supporting axis is capable of being transmitted via the sliding element to the supporting element. So that the sliding element and the sliding profile are subject to reduced wear, the sliding element is a rotatable rolling element, so that in the operating state the supporting element is capable of being unrolled over the rotatable rolling element along the sliding profile.

  • Patent number: 5492153
    Abstract: A weft yarn presentation apparatus has a weft sequence control having weft thread presenting devices (1), a controlled thread clamping device (2) with several clamps (3a-3f) and a guide member (4) with a slit (5). The association of the weft thread presenting devices (1) with the clamps (3a-3f) guarantees that there is no cross-over of the tracks of the weft threads, and the displacement of the clamps in the reference plane (6) does not influence these tracks. The weft thread is presented to the gripper in the reference plane (6), through matching of the movements of the clamp and of the associated weft thread presenting device (1) so that contact between the weft threads is prevented.

  • Patent number: 5241994
    Abstract: A rapier loom has a picking mechanism in which one rapier (a giver rapier) transfers a weft yarn to another rapier (a taker rapier) in mid-shed. Each rapier is oscillated toward and away from one another by a drive and includes a yarn clamp which is actuated by a clamp opener to provide reliable yarn transfer from one rapier to the other. The rapier drives and/or clamp openers are driven by programmed servomotors. In this way, the velocities of the rapiers and/or the interval in which the clamp openers are opened can be adjusted according to the properties of the particular weft yarns used to ensure reliable transfer without damaging the yarn.

  • Patent number: 5058628
    Abstract: To operate the terry loom, one or more pile-forming elements is actuated by separate drives on an individual pick basis and in a freely triggerable manner and at a loom speed. Any desired terry cadence can be produced in any desired sequence without stopping the loom and changing mechanical control and actuating means. Pile height can also be varied as required. The terry loom has at least one servomotor as a separate drive. The servomotor, which is triggered by means of a control and adjustment circuit arrangement, drives the pile-forming element by way of a reduction transmission and transmission elements. The servomotor can be preferably brushless and electronically commutated and have a low mass inertia rotor and high-field strength permanent magnets.

  • Patent number: 4690176
    Abstract: In a back rest arrangement on a weaving machine the back rest is preferably carried at each of its ends by one arm of a two-armed support frame or yoke which is pivotable about a stationary pivot axis on a machine frame. At least one of the arms of the support frame or yoke possesses a resilient portion or shank. A free end of the resilient shank is supported in a manner which is relatively rigid in relation to a pivoting motion of the support frame or yoke caused by the varying warp force acting on the back rest. The resilient shank is in operative association with a sensing probe for generating an electrical signal which is proportional to the deflection of the resilient shank. These measures render the arrangement suitable both for a so-called rigid or fixed back rest support as well as for a back rest support utilizing a rocking lever or rocker beam.

  • Patent number: 4607666
    Abstract: The apparatus for controlling the warp thread tension by positional displacement of a back rest on a loom includes a swivelling lever mechanism with a rocking lever which carries the shaft of the back rest and which rocking lever is controlled by a cam plate or disc. The apparatus also includes additional members effecting an additional warp thread tensioning by an additional positional displacement of the back rest during the start-up operation of the loom. The swivelling lever mechanism further includes a connecting element which serves for altering the relative distance between the cam plate or disc and the rocking lever carrying the shaft of the back rest. The relative length of the connecting element is variable by a temporarily operative actuating device. These measures permit a very simple and functionally reliable concept of the additional members of the apparatus.
